Mahoghany color with a finger of off white foam and spotty lace.
Exceptional herbal, nutmeg, floral aromas from the Underberg "barrel".
Taste has a little more noticeable licorice, complex mix with the smoke and nutty malt of the base beer. Herbal and floral accents, sassafras and anise similar to Ricola candy. It verges on medicinal territory, much like Underberg. Dry and tannic oak finish with some light astringency.
Overall it’s unusual, but the beer and barrel play complimentary roles here. Experimental and unique brew, going further down the barrel-aging rabbit hole...
